    I don’t want to side track this great thread but I need some schooling. I’ve been trying to put together a 32 grill and insert for one of my Model As for some time now. I found an original shell a few years ago and have been looking for an insert. A friend is working on a 32 and has an original insert loose so I took my shell over to see how it fit, the attached picture. The insert is rounded along the bottom where my shell comes to a point. Looking at all the pictures in this thread I see several rounded and pointed shells being called out as originals. My question is did Ford have different grille shapes in 32? Different months, models, countries? Why the difference?

  15. Rick,the truck insert and shell is a one piece and the shape is slightly different.

    The one on the left is a passenger car grille shell,the one on the right is a truck. HRP upload_2018-2-28_12-49-14.jpeg
